Jaime Yllana apologizes for father Anjo Yllana’s tirades, urges privacy amid controversy

Actor Jaime Yllana, one of the cast members of the upcoming Viva One series ‘My Husband Is a Mafia Boss’, publicly apologized for the controversial remarks made by his father, Anjo Yllana, against his former ‘Eat Bulaga!’ colleagues.

Jaime addressed the issue during the cast reveal media conference for ‘My Husband Is a Mafia Boss’, held at Viva Café in Quezon City on Thursday night, January 8, 2026. The event introduced the Wattpad-to-screen adaptation headlined by Joseph Marco and Rhen Escaño.

Questions about Anjo Yllana were inevitable, following the veteran actor’s viral online tirades in late 2025 targeting his former ‘Eat Bulaga!’ co-workers. On December 1, 2025, Anjo announced that he would stop speaking publicly about the issue, which eventually led to a slowdown in online backlash.

Speaking to the entertainment press, Jaime expressed remorse over his father’s statements while stressing his position as a son.

“Yung tatay ko kasi, at the end of the day, he’s my dad. Sa bahay, tatay ko talaga siya, so nakikita ko talaga yung pinagdadaanan niya,” Jaime said. “Alam ko naman, pasensiya po sa lahat, na may nagagawa siyang mali at naiintindihan ko naman na ganoon talaga.”

Jaime emphasized that despite the controversy, Anjo remains his father, whom he loves and respects.

“Wala, tatay ko siya. Mahal ko siya kaya kailangan kong intindihin na ganoon siya. Bigyan siya ng advice,” he said.
“Kahit anong maling gawin ng tatay ko, kailangan kong matutong pagbigyan siya. Siyempre, siya yung nagpalaki sa akin. I wouldn’t be here without him.”

The young actor also described his relationship with his father as close and candid, likening it to that of siblings or best friends, which allows him to speak honestly with Anjo.

“Honestly, parang magkapatid kami. Para kaming mag-bestfriend,” Jaime shared. “Sinasabi ko lang sa kanya na, ‘Alam mo minsan sa buhay, kailangan i-keep private.’ Like siyempre, artista tayo or in the spotlight, but some things need to be in private.”

In a separate interview with other entertainment outlets, Jaime said he believes his father took the advice to heart.

“Naintindihan naman niya noong sinabi ko sa kanya na some things need to be kept private. Doon siya nagbago, tinigil na niya,” he said.

Addressing reports that Anjo could potentially face legal complaints over his remarks, Jaime clarified that his father must take responsibility for his own actions.

“Well, I’m not my dad. Personally, as a son, I would feel bad for him,” he said. “But I hope he gets to arrange everything accordingly. Deep down inside, he thinks what he’s doing is right, that is to defend people. Pero he just didn’t deliver it the right way.”

Jaime concluded by expressing confidence that his father would own up to his mistakes and improve moving forward.

“He’s gonna own up to his own mistakes. Ganun naman siyang tao—alam niyang mali siya, he’s gonna be better,” he said.

‘My Husband Is a Mafia Boss’, based on the popular Wattpad novel by the late author Yanalovesyouu, is set to stream on Viva One and marks one of Jaime Yllana’s notable projects as he continues to build his acting career.
